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-39170

Add testing where we sleep during critical sections of the TransactionParticipant

    XMLWordPrintable

    Details

      Description

      Examples of "critical sections":

      • Between reserving the prepare/commit timestamp and committing the oplog entry
      • Between committing a prepared transaction and committing the oplog entry

      This is likely the lowest priority of our "Prepare Transactions" testing. It could potentially surface race conditions in an easier to debug way.

        Attachments

          Activity

            People

            Assignee:
            backlog-server-repl Backlog - Replication Team
            Reporter:
            judah.schvimer Judah Schvimer
            Participants:
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: